Women's Hoops Part of Tip-Off Marathon

Aug. 16, 2010

WACO, Texas - Baylor women's basketball will play Connecticut in Hartford, Conn., as part of ESPN's third annual College Hoops Tip-Off Marathon on Tue., Nov. 16, at 5 p.m. CT on ESPN2 and ESPN3.com. The Baylor/UConn game is the only women's contest included in the marathon.

The Lady Bears and the Huskies will be one of 12 live college basketball games in 24 consecutive hours on ESPN for the second straight season. Overall, ESPN's celebration of the opening of the college basketball season will include 20 live games - 19 men's and one women's - in a minimum of 25.5 hours across ESPN, ESPN2 and ESPNU. ESPN3.com will offer two exclusive games as well as a simulcast of every ESPN and ESPN2 telecast. The 24-hour marathon kicks off at Mon., Nov. 15, at 11 p.m. CT when the Miami Hurricanes face the Memphis Tigers on ESPN.

The women's contest will feature two-time defending national champion Connecticut against a Baylor team that returns four starters including 6-foot-8 center Brittney Griner. Connecticut, which enters the season with a 78-game winning streak, defeated Baylor 70-50 in the semifinals of the NCAA Tournament last season. Both teams are expected to open the season ranked in the top 5.

In addition, Baylor's men's team will be a part of ESPN's 24 hours of basketball for the second time when they host La Salle at 1 p.m. CT on ESPN and ESPN3.com.
